Sectional play rolled on across Section V Friday despite poor weather conditions, with several Wayne-Finger Lakes teams advancing to the next round.
Mynderse’s Alan Plummer dazzled in a dominant shutout, fanning 14 and earning his 300th career strikeout, while Rylee Richardson tossed a five-inning no-hitter with 11 strikeouts to lead Lyons softball. In other action, Geneva baseball pulled off an upset, and Palmyra-Macedon softball shut out Wayne.

BASEBALL
Class AA – Second Round
No. 14 Spencerport 2
No. 3 Victor 9
Will Elkovitch jump-started the Blue Devils’ offense with a two-run double in the first inning, setting the tone early. Matty Eygabroad added a two-run single in the same frame as Victor built a lead they never gave up. Jack Guiffre pitched 3.2 strong innings, allowing just one hit with five strikeouts, while Bradon Wilson closed the door with 10 outs and five punchouts in relief. Matthew Lanning, John Swartz, and Alex Long each chipped in with RBI singles.

Class B – Second Round
No. 11 Bishop Kearney/Chesterton 0
No. 6 Mynderse 19
Alan Plummer was dominant on the mound for the Blue Devils, tossing six one-hit innings with 14 strikeouts while also reaching the 300-career strikeout milestone. He added a single, three walks, and an RBI at the plate. Calabro Mahoney led the offense with two doubles and three RBI, while Jeremiah Furman chipped in with a single, double, and two RBI. Mynderse racked up hits from across the lineup, including RBI singles from Josh Hutchins, Aiden Levis, Byron Catalano, and Michael Miller.
Class C1 – First Round
No. 9 Byron-Bergen 2
No. 8 Williamson 3
Caiden Watson sparked the Marauders with an RBI double in the fourth inning to break a tie and give the Wiliamson a lead they wouldn’t give up. The team plated three runs in the frame, with David DeFisher and Charles Walter each delivering RBI singles. DeFisher was dominant on the mound, tossing a complete game with 12 strikeouts while allowing just one earned run on six hits. He also went 2-for-4 with an RBI and a run scored, while Watson finished 2-for-2.

Class A – First Round
No. 9 Palmyra-Macedon 7
No. 8 Wayne 0
The Red Raiders jumped out to a six-run lead in the first inning and never looked back. Seager Emerick struck out 10 and allowed just three hits in a strong performance from the circle, while also collecting two hits and an RBI at the plate. Addison Gendron and Emmalynne Bedette each added two hits and an RBI, with Bedette also doubling. Jillian Anthony drove in a run, and Elianna Rouland and Briana VanHaneghan chipped in hits.

Class C1 – First Round
No. 15 Williamson 0
No. 2 Lyons 14
Rylee Richardson was dominant in the circle for for the Lions, throwing a five-inning no-hitter with 11 strikeouts and four walks. She also contributed at the plate with an RBI single and two walks, while Baylei Reed led the offense with two doubles and three RBI. Addison VanLare added an RBI single, and Lyons showed patience at the plate, drawing 10 walks as a team.
